Sway 1.6 (и wlroots 0.13.0) — композитор для Wayland, совместимый с i3
Вышла новая версия фреймового Wayland-композитора (с поддержкой XWayland) Sway 1.6, совместимого с фреймовым X11-оконным менеджером i3. Также обновлена библиотека wlroots 0.13.0, позволяющая разрабатывать другие композиторы для Wayland. В этом выпуске 69 разработчиков внесли 231 изменение, обеспечивающее множество новых функций и исправлений ошибок.
Это первый мажорный выпуск, подготовленный новым мейнтейнером Simon Ser после того, как оригинальный автор Drew DeVault передал ему проекты Sway и wlroots и ушёл развивать собственную платформу совместной разработки sourcehut, разрабатывать новый язык программирования и заниматься другими делами.
Основные изменения:
- улучшена поддержка редактора метода ввода (IME — Input Method Editor): лучшая поддержка азиатских CJK-языков (китайского, японского, корейского), добавлена поддержка ввода на элементах рабочего стола (например, на панели и экране блокировки);
- более плавная работа интерактивного перемещения окна и изменения его размера;
- программы, установленные с помощью Flatpak и Snap, теперь смогут лучше интегрироваться со Sway, используя Wayland-протокол xdg-foreign;
- улучшена совместимость с i3 по командам изменения схемы расположения окон;
- добавлена настройка скрытия курсора во время печати на клавиатуре;
- добавлена поддержка иконок в трее для систем без systemd/elogind;
- улучшена работа с буфером обмена X11.
>>> Подробности